No. 98/1946 - Árachas Náisiúta Shláinte (National Health Insurance) Arrears Amendment Regulations, 1946. S.I. No. 98/1946 - Árachas Náisiúta Shláinte (National Health Insurance) Arrears Amendment Regulations, 1946. AmendmentsLeasuithe S.R. & O., 1945, No. 58. I, FRANCIS CONSTANTINE WARD, Parliamentary Secretary to the Minister for Local Government and Public Health, in exercise of the powers conferred on the said Minister by the National Health Insurance Acts, 1911 to 1942, and by virtue of the Local Government and Public Health (Delegation of Ministerial Functions) Order, 1945, hereby make the following Regulations, that is to say :— 1. These Regulations may be cited as the National Health Insurance (Arrears) Amendment Regulations, 1946, and shall be read as one with the National Health Insurance (Arrears) Regulations, 1921 to 1929. S.R. & O., 1923, No. 6. 2. The following Article shall be substituted for Article 15 of the Arrears Regulations, 1921, as amended by Article 5 of the Arrears Amendment Regulations, 1923 : 15. For the purposes of sub-section

(4)of Section 13 of the Act of 1918—
(1)any period of which no account is taken in calculating arrears of contributions under paragraph
(2)of Article 3 of these Regulations shall be deemed to be a period in respect of which notice has been given within the prescribed time,
(2)the prescribed time shall, in the case of a person (including a deceased person) by or in respect of whom it is proved that he is or was incapable of work owing to some specific disease or bodily or mental disablement for a period in respect of which no benefit has been paid or is payable, be to period from the commencement of the incapacity to the expiration of three months after the end of the in capacity or such longer period as the Minister may in any particular case determine. F. C. WARD, Parliamentary Secretary to the Minister for Local Government and Public Health.. Dated this 4th day of April, 1946.
